The latter part of her life was marked by both continued artistic output and significant personal hardship. She suffered through turbulent relationships, including a volatile marriage to manager Andy Stroud, and experienced periods of mental health struggles. Despite these challenges, her commitment to her craft never wavered. She lived in various places, including Barbados and France, which influenced her musical style and provided different economic contexts for her work. By the time of her death in 2003, her body of work was immense and her influence immeasurable. Calculating her net worth at that point involved cataloging not only her bank accounts and property but also the rights to her vast musical catalog. Publishers and recording studios held the rights to her master recordings, which are perpetual assets. Estimates placed her net worth between $1.2 million and $5 million at the time of her death. While these figures are substantial, they arguably undersell the true value of her legacy. Her music continues to generate significant revenue through streams, licensing for films, television, and commercials, ensuring that her net worth, in a cultural and financial sense, continues to grow long after her death, a timeless testament to the enduring power of her art and her message.
From this intellectual breakthrough emerged a company built on the principle of research and development. Unlike many of its competitors driven by marketing trends, Bose remained steadfastly committed to its founding philosophy of "Better through research." This dedication required significant investment, a factor that directly contributes to the Bose net worth and financial structure. The company operated for years, often in the red, plowing profits back into its labs rather than chasing immediate profitability. This long-term vision was crucial. While competitors chased fads, Bose was busy engineering esfand net worth the future of sound. The first product to showcase this technology was the iconic Bose 901, introduced in 1968. Its unconventional design, featuring nine small drivers spread across a sleek console, was met with skepticism by the industry establishment. Critics dismissed it as a cumbersome experiment. Yet, consumers heard the difference. The 901’s ability to fill a room with balanced, immersive sound established a new benchmark for home audio. This success provided the capital and credibility needed to expand beyond the high-end audiophile market and into other sectors.

A key driver behind the accumulation of his considerable Nobu Matsuhisa net worth is the brand's unique and highly successful expansion strategy. Unlike many chef-led restaurants that remain limited to a single location, Matsuhisa embraced the concept of franchising and partnerships early on. He formed a powerful alliance with businessman Robert De Niro, not just as a fellow celebrity but as a strategic partner in the global licensing of the Nobu name. This allowed the brand to proliferate rapidly across major cities worldwide, from Las Vegas and London to Tokyo and Shanghai. Each new location, whether a standalone restaurant, a hotel affiliation, or a more casual bistro, generates significant revenue streams through licensing fees, royalties, and operational profits, all of which funnel back into the central empire and enhance his overall Nobu Matsuhisa net worth.
